在当前移动互联网快速发展的背景下,公众号系统开发已成为企业数字化转型的重要环节。越来越多的组织希望通过微信生态构建高效、稳定的用户触达与服务管理体系。然而,在实际开发过程中,许多团队往往将重点放在功能实现和上线速度上,忽视了系统底层架构设计与安全机制的完善,从而埋下诸多隐患。这些隐患不仅影响系统的稳定性与可维护性,更可能引发数据泄露、接口滥用等严重问题,最终导致品牌形象受损甚至法律风险。
系统架构设计中的潜在风险
在公众号系统开发初期,若采用单体架构或过度耦合的设计模式,极易造成代码冗余、模块间依赖混乱的问题。当业务需求不断扩展时,修改一个功能可能牵动整个系统,调试成本急剧上升。尤其在高并发场景下,系统响应延迟、服务崩溃等问题频发,直接影响用户体验。因此,引入微服务架构是提升系统可维护性的关键一步。通过将认证、消息推送、用户管理、订单处理等功能拆分为独立服务,不仅能实现资源的弹性分配,还能降低故障传播范围,提高整体容灾能力。同时,合理的服务注册与发现机制,配合API网关统一入口管理,也能有效防止接口暴露带来的安全隐患。
数据安全与权限控制不容忽视
公众号系统中涉及大量用户敏感信息,如手机号、身份证号、支付记录等,一旦发生泄露,后果不堪设想。部分开发者在数据库设计阶段未对字段进行加密存储,或使用明文传输敏感数据,为黑客攻击提供了可乘之机。此外,权限管理机制不健全也是常见漏洞之一。例如,普通管理员账号拥有越权操作的能力,或后台接口缺乏访问频率限制,容易被恶意调用。针对这些问题,应严格执行最小权限原则,结合OAuth2.0协议实现安全的第三方授权流程,并对每个接口设置身份验证与请求签名机制。同时,定期进行渗透测试与漏洞扫描,及时修复已知风险点。

第三方接口集成的合规性挑战
在公众号系统开发中,常需对接微信官方提供的各类接口,如模板消息、用户标签、地理位置获取等。若未严格按照官方文档规范调用,或擅自缓存用户数据,极有可能触发平台封禁风险。更有甚者,一些开发者为了追求效率,直接调用非官方接口或使用爬虫技术抓取数据,这不仅违反《微信公众号平台运营规范》,还可能面临法律追责。建议所有接口调用均通过官方开放平台完成,启用服务器端令牌(access_token)自动刷新机制,并对每次调用结果做日志记录与异常捕获,确保操作可追溯、可审计。
监控体系与日志审计的建设必要性
一个成熟的公众号系统开发项目,必须具备完善的运行监控与日志审计能力。从接口调用次数、响应时间到错误率统计,都需要实时采集并可视化展示。通过部署Prometheus+Grafana等开源工具组合,可以构建完整的性能监控视图。同时,关键操作行为(如删除用户数据、修改权限配置)应记录完整日志,包括操作人、时间戳、IP地址及具体变更内容,以便后续追溯。对于异常行为,如短时间内大量失败登录尝试,系统应能自动触发告警并采取临时封禁措施,避免攻击持续扩大。
从源头规避风险,构建可持续运营体系
公众号系统开发不应只关注“能不能跑”,更要思考“能不能稳”“能不能长期用”。企业在选择开发团队或自建技术力量时,应优先考虑具备成熟项目经验与安全意识的团队。特别是在系统设计阶段就引入安全左移理念,将风险评估贯穿于需求分析、架构设计、编码实现、测试验证各环节,才能真正实现“防患于未然”。此外,定期组织内部培训,提升开发人员对数据保护、合规要求的认知水平,也是保障系统长期健康运行的重要一环。
在公众号系统开发过程中,每一个细节都可能成为决定成败的关键。我们专注于为企业提供定制化、高可用、强安全的公众号解决方案,深耕行业多年,积累了丰富的实战经验,擅长处理复杂业务逻辑与高并发场景下的系统优化问题,致力于帮助客户打造稳定、可信、可持续运营的服务平台,助力品牌在微信生态中实现长效增长,17723342546
欢迎微信扫码咨询
扫码了解更多